Lagumenahalli - Bengaluru East, Bengaluru Urban

Lagumenahalli is a village situated in the Bengaluru East taluka of Bengaluru Urban district, Karnataka. It is located approximately 28 km from Bangalore East and around 28 km from Bangalore East. Manduru serves as the Gram Panchayat for Lagumenahalli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Lagumenahalli is 613096. The village covers a total geographical area of 32.37 hectares and falls under the 560008 pincode. Hosakote is the nearest town, located about 5 km away.

Lagumenahalli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Mahadevapura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bengaluru Central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Lagumenahalli

As per Census 2011, Lagumenahalli village has a total population of 306 people, consisting of 163 males and 143 females. The village has 63 households and a sex ratio of 877 females per 1,000 males. There are 36 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 167 literate and 139 illiterate residents. Additionally, 48 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Lagumenahalli

Lagumenahalli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Hosakote to Lagumenahalli is about 5 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Bangalore East to Lagumenahalli is about 28 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
